Maxima Noise on front end

Wondering if someone can help me.. I have a maxima 2002 SE with only 11,500 miles and starting 4 months ago there is a noise coming from the front left tire (Drivers Side) when going over a bump under 10mph, anything over that the road noise it to load and you cannot hear it.. It thought it was the strut that went bad, so last week I brought it to the dealer took a mechanic for a ride and he confirmed the problem. They replaced the struts and the problem was still there, then they said it was some kind of part in steering and replaced that part and still the problem is there, I’m ****ed because this car is like new and they are pretty much putting there hands on everything, the noise sound like a load ticking noise but its hard to describe it.. Does anyone know what is going on?? I hate when the dealer touch’s things because they never put everything back on right including paneling, screws, etc...

Help..

I've had the same problem on mine. 2001 AE (Canadian) - It makes a groaning noise in the front driver's side. Going over bumps or when making a right hand turn only. First time I took it in, they told me it was something on the sway bar, which they replaced. That didn't work, noise was still there. Back to the dealer again, they decided to replace the driver's side strut, but the next day - the noise is still there. I am dropping off the car next week and leaving it overnight so they can figure out the problem. I am tired of listening to the awful groaning noise. The dealer is having a hard time determing what the problem is. I am just over 60K (Canadian) on mine, which means they will still cover the work under warranty.
Has anyone else had a hard time with this??
